This paper attempts to reinterpret Liang’s thoughts from the perspective of "power". He had been thinking about the question of "how was Chinese type of dynamic possible". Liang not only took material resources as dynamic, but regarded mind power as dynamic, and on this account he structured trilogy of dynamism:dynamic, material resources and mind power.Liang Qichao’s reflections on "dynamism" first pointed to "the restructuring of cosmology". The traditional the universe noumenon of "void quietness" showed up as cosmology of "dynamism" in Liang’s thoughts. Liang overturned the ancient cosmology with theory of power, and then replaced "final cause" with "efficient cause".By means of the paradigm of thought of traditional philosophy that "human conducts should be in conformity with the Dao of heaven", Liang started thinking about the motivation of historical evolution. In his opinion, historical evolution needed "competition" and "creation" and must think about "violence" at the same time.Liang’s thinking about "material resources" was at first related to the dominant theme of the times of "prosperity". In the view of seeking prosperousness, material resources was manifested as economic and military might. If prosperity of material resources was the superficial goal of nation, the progress of material resources was the further appeal. The prevailing of material resources in modern times certainly needed philosophical justification. According to Liang’s view, the philosophical foundation of the view of material resources contained two levels:the overturn in value of "debate on justice and interest" and the logical spread of "competition between heavenly principle and human desire" in modern times.Liang made it clear that "mind power" was more important than "material resources" on the question of "the seek of power". Liang’s understanding of mind power contained four levels:the first was mind power in the psychological sense; the second was in the ontological sense; the third was in the sense of moral philosophy; the last one was in the sense of philosophy of history. Furthermore, he took mutual explanation between mind power and willpower, and then put forward the theory of free will. He not only examined closely how "free will" was possible, but realized internal tension between "free will" and "determinism", and then tried to work through the internal tension with "compatibilism". Moreover, Liang also got a glimpse of "the weakness of will" of Chinese at that time, which made him begin to think about how did the weakness of will happen and proposed solutions to overcome the weakness of will.And what is more important, Liang not only had structured the philosophical system of "dynamism", but also had been rethinking "dynamism" itself. Virtually, on the one hand the rethinking based on Records of Travels in Europe could be deemed as reflection on "evolutionism in China", on the other hand it could be regarded as rethinking about "modernistic way of China". Therefore, Liang’s diagnosis of modernistic crisis could be regarded as a thinking direction for "modernistic theory of anti-modernity".
